The Imber Ultra is a challenging trail run of over 33 miles across the Wiltshire countryside, blending tough terrain with great views. The next edition is on 1 March 2026 and entries are expected to open around October 2025.
Tackle the Hateful 8 Ultra Loop on 7 March 2026 at Bridgend. Run as many 9 mile loops as you can in 8 hours over mixed terrain with steep climbs and technical forest descents, plus support, snacks and a bespoke finish medal.

Run a scenic loop through the Forest of Dean on well maintained trails with gentle climbs. Officially measured and fully marshalled, this spring half hosts the British Trail Running Championships.
